Sat 697830602677848

decimal
139566.602677848
degree
0°139566′462″602677848‴
percentile
33.23002873549819%
name
ixflzevyxwz
cycle
0
epoch
0
period
69
block
139566
offset
602677848
timestamp
rarity
common